ANNOUNCEMENT
After discussions we have decided to waive the tournament entry fee to the Dead or Alive 5 Singles Tournament!
That's right, it is free to enter the tournament! This does not mean that there will be no prizes to the entrants who place in the tournament. In addition to winning their own copy of Dead or Alive 5's Collector's Edition for the system of their choosing when the game releases, there is a pot prize of $500 provided by myself and Erik "Rikuto" Argetsinger to be divided up by the top three of the tournament in a 70/20/10 split.

Tigre, may I appeal that we try Waseda format for this team tournament? We haven't used it since WinterBrawl 4, but I think it will be fun.
It's simple in a 2v2,
Team A player 1 and Team B's player 1 fight each other.
Team A player 2 and Team B's player 2 fight each other.
If a team wins both matches, that team wins. If a team loses both matches, that team loses.
If a team wins one and loses one, the winning players fight each other. It keeps the event short, streamlined, but also guarantees that everyone who entered teams plays. It requires no extra management on your part, the teams can certainly do this themselves.
Of course standard format is better for 3v3 though.
